Formula 1 Team Principal Toto Wolff's Assets Examined: An In-Depth Analysis of the Prosperity of the Team Leader
**Introduction**
Austrian motorsport figurehead Toto Wolff has made a name for himself in the world of Formula 1 (F1), not only as a team principal but also as a shrewd investor and businessman. With an estimated wealth of 1.6 billion US dollars, according to Swiss magazine Bilanz, Wolff is one of the wealthiest personalities in motorsport.

**Wealth Growth and Business Acumen**
Wolff's wealth is not solely derived from his salary but also from strategic investments and company shares. He is a shareholder in racing teams, starting with Williams and later Mercedes, which has significantly contributed to his wealth as Mercedes dominated the sport.
His transition from driver to business leader and investor has leveraged the increasing commercial value of F1, positioning him among the wealthier figures in the sport.
